Bristol's On Site Apprentice Of The Year Announced

Bristol's On Site Apprentice of the Year is Tom Trevett of Kingswood.

Tom, who completed an Advanced Apprenticeship in Bricklaying in July, will now represent On Site and City of Bristol College as one of only 12 finalists in this year's national SkillBuild Final in Glasgow - 6 to 9 October 2009.

His employer, Simon Thompson, Director of Kingswood Construction Ltd said: "We are delighted for Tom. Ever since On Site introduced him to Kingswood Construction he has shown an exceptional talent in his trade. Tom is 100% reliable and learns quickly, so I am not surprised he has reached a national final recognising his skills. Winning the On Site award means a lot to Tom - it comes from hard work and determination."

Lord Mayor of Bristol, Councillor Christopher Davies, presented awards to twelve apprentice plumbers, electricians, bricklayers, plasterers and carpenters, as well as their employers, tutors and other supporters.

Set up in 1997 to promote the use of local labour in construction and apprenticeships, On Site Bristol is a partnership between Bristol City Council, Jobcentre Plus, Learning and Skills Council, Construction Skills and City of Bristol College. The annual awards recognise skills, dedication and achievements of young people involved in the programme, as well as the support they receive in the workplace.
